Maslow's Hierarchy
A psychological theory proposed by Abraham Maslow that categorizes human needs into a five-tier model in the shape of a pyramid, starting from basic physiological needs to self-actualization at the top.
McClelland
David McClelland, a psychologist known for his work on motivation and the theory of Needs, including Achievement, Affiliation, and Power.
